数据指标命名规范
指标命名规范
在数据仓库中,指标是用来衡量业务表现和性能的重要标准,因此指标的命名规范至关重要。合理的指标命名可以提高数据的可读性、可理解性和可维护性,帮助业务团队更好地理解和使用数据。下面是一份指标命名规范的示例:
规范要求 | 示例 | 解释 |
---|---|---|
清晰明了 | order_quantity | 订单数量 |
使用业务术语 | sales_revenue | 销售收入 |
避免缩写和简写 | customer_retention_rate | 客户保留率(表示客户在一定时间内继续购买的比率) |
采用统一前缀 | marketing_clicks | 营销点击数 |
使用下划线分隔单词 | average_order_value | 平均订单金额 |
区分大小写 | ActiveUsers | 活跃用户数 |
包含时间维度 | monthly_sales_revenue | 月度销售收入 |
避免使用特殊字符 | bounce_rate | 跳出率(表示访问网站后只访问一个页面就离开的比率) |
与业务需求保持一致 | customer_churn_rate | 客户流失率(表示某个时间段内不再购买的客户比率) |
文档化 | conversion_rate | 转化率(表示某个目标的实现比率) |
解释
清晰明了:指标名称应该简洁明了,能够准确反映指标所衡量的业务内容,例如订单数量表示数据中记录的订单数量。
使用业务术语:指标名称应该使用业务术语,而不是技术术语,以便业务人员能够直观理解,例如销售收入表示数据中的销售总额。
避免缩写和简写:尽量避免使用缩写和简写,以免引起歧义和误解,例如客户保留率而不是使用Cust_Ret_Rate。
采用统一前缀:可以采用统一的前缀来标识指标所属的业务领域,便于分类和查找,例如营销点击数中使用Marketing_作为前缀。
使用下划线分隔单词:指标名称可以使用下划线来分隔单词,提高可读性,例如平均订单金额。
区分大小写:指标名称可以区分大小写,但要保持一致性,避免混淆,例如活跃用户数的ActiveUsers首字母大写。
包含时间维度:对于随时间变化的指标,建议在名称中包含时间维度,以便识别指标的时间范围,例如月度销售收入。
避免使用特殊字符:指标名称应避免使用特殊字符,以免影响数据处理和查询,例如跳出率。
与业务需求保持一致:指标名称应与业务需求保持一致,不应随意更改,例如客户流失率。
文档化:及时记录指标的定义和含义,形成数据词典或文档,方便团队成员查阅,例如转化率表示某个目标的实现比率。
通过遵循上述指标命名规范,数据团队和业务团队能够更好地理解和使用数据,提高数据仓库的维护和管理效率。同时,指标命名规范也是数据治理的一部分,有助于提高数据的质量和一致性。